
Excel设置公式日期的方法有:使用DATE函数、TEXT函数、TODAY函数、和日期运算。 在Excel中,日期和时间的处理一直是一个重要且常见的需求。通过理解和运用这些函数,你可以更高效地管理和分析数据。下面将详细介绍如何使用这些方法设置和处理Excel中的日期公式。
一、DATE函数
1、DATE函数的基本用法
DATE函数用于生成特定的日期格式,语法为DATE(year, month, day)。例如,=DATE(2023, 10, 5)将返回2023年10月5日。
2、动态生成日期
假如我们需要根据某个年份和月来生成日期,可以结合其他函数使用。例如,生成某年某月的第一天:
=DATE(A1, B1, 1)
这里,A1单元格存放年份,B1单元格存放月份。
3、生成当月最后一天
通过DATE函数可以计算出特定月份的最后一天:
=DATE(A1, B1+1, 1)-1
这表示获取下个月的第一天,再减去一天。
二、TEXT函数
1、TEXT函数的基本用法
TEXT函数用于将日期或数字格式化为文本,语法为TEXT(value, format_text)。例如,=TEXT(TODAY(), "yyyy-mm-dd")将返回当前日期,并以"年-月-日"的格式显示。
2、格式化日期
我们可以使用TEXT函数将日期格式化为不同的显示形式。例如:
=TEXT(A1, "dd/mm/yyyy")
这里,A1单元格存放日期。
三、TODAY函数
1、TODAY函数的基本用法
TODAY函数返回当前日期,语法为TODAY()。它没有参数,始终返回当前系统日期。
2、动态日期计算
可以利用TODAY函数进行动态日期计算,例如:
=TODAY()+7
这将返回当前日期后七天的日期。
四、日期运算
1、日期加减
Excel中的日期可以直接进行加减运算。比如,计算某日期的前后几天:
=A1+30
这将返回A1单元格日期之后的30天。
2、DATEDIF函数
DATEDIF函数用于计算两个日期之间的间隔,语法为DATEDIF(start_date, end_date, unit)。单位可以是“Y”表示年,“M”表示月,“D”表示日。例如:
=DATEDIF(A1, B1, "D")
这将返回A1和B1之间的天数差。
五、结合使用多个函数
1、复杂日期计算
为了更复杂的日期计算,可以结合多个函数。例如,计算某年某月的最后一个工作日,可以结合WORKDAY函数:
=WORKDAY(DATE(A1, B1+1, 1)-1, -1)
这将返回A1单元格存放年份,B1单元格存放月份的最后一个工作日。
2、条件判断
可以结合IF函数进行条件判断。例如,根据某日期判断是否是周末:
=IF(OR(WEEKDAY(A1)=1, WEEKDAY(A1)=7), "是周末", "不是周末")
这里,A1单元格存放日期。
六、日期格式设置
1、自定义日期格式
Excel允许用户自定义日期格式。例如,右键单元格,选择“设置单元格格式”,然后在“数字”选项卡中选择“自定义”,输入所需的日期格式代码。例如,“yyyy年m月d日”。
2、区域设置
不同的区域日期格式可能不同,确保在Excel中选择正确的区域设置。可以通过“文件”->“选项”->“语言”进行设置。
七、日期的常见问题
1、日期显示为数字
这是因为Excel将日期存储为序列号,可以通过设置单元格格式为日期来解决。
2、日期计算错误
确保日期格式一致,避免文本格式的日期参与计算。
八、日期与时间的结合
1、日期与时间的组合
可以通过DATE函数和TIME函数组合日期和时间。例如:
=DATE(A1, B1, C1) + TIME(D1, E1, F1)
这里,A1、B1、C1存放年、月、日,D1、E1、F1存放时、分、秒。
2、提取时间部分
如果需要从日期时间中提取时间部分,可以使用MOD函数:
=MOD(A1, 1)
这里,A1单元格存放日期时间。
九、日期的条件格式
1、条件格式基本用法
条件格式可以根据日期值的不同进行不同的格式化。例如,设置过去七天内的日期为红色:
=TODAY()-A1<=7
然后设置格式为红色。
2、复杂条件
可以结合AND、OR等函数进行复杂条件设置。例如,同时满足多个条件:
=AND(A1>TODAY(), A1<TODAY()+30)
这将格式化未来30天内的日期。
十、总结
通过以上方法,我们可以在Excel中灵活处理各种日期相关的问题。掌握DATE函数、TEXT函数、TODAY函数、和日期运算,以及结合使用多个函数,可以极大提高数据处理的效率和准确性。此外,自定义日期格式、条件格式等功能的使用,也能让数据展示更加直观和美观。希望这篇文章能够帮助你更好地理解和应用Excel中的日期功能。
相关问答FAQs:
1. 如何在Excel中设置日期公式?
在Excel中设置日期公式非常简单。您可以使用以下步骤:
- 选择您要放置日期公式的单元格。
- 输入等号(=)符号,然后输入日期函数名称,例如“TODAY”(表示当天日期)或“DATE”(表示自定义日期)。
- 根据函数的参数要求,输入相应的参数,例如“TODAY”函数不需要参数,而“DATE”函数需要输入年、月、日的参数。
- 按下回车键,Excel将自动计算并显示相应的日期。
2. 如何在Excel中使用日期公式进行日期计算?
您可以使用日期公式在Excel中进行各种日期计算。以下是一些常用的日期公式示例:
- 使用“DATEDIF”函数计算两个日期之间的天数、月数或年数。
- 使用“EOMONTH”函数计算指定日期的月末日期。
- 使用“WORKDAY”函数计算指定日期之后的第N个工作日。
- 使用“NETWORKDAYS”函数计算两个日期之间的工作日数量。
3. 如何在Excel中格式化日期公式的显示方式?
在Excel中,您可以通过以下步骤格式化日期公式的显示方式:
- 选择包含日期公式的单元格。
- 单击“开始”选项卡上的“格式”按钮。
- 选择“数字”类别,并选择您喜欢的日期格式,例如“短日期”、“长日期”、“自定义”等。
- 单击“确定”按钮,Excel将按照您选择的日期格式显示日期公式的结果。
请注意,日期格式化仅影响显示方式,并不改变日期公式的计算结果。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4594625